(Anonymous) 2013-02-27 01:26 am (UTC)(link)Each individual Doctor is, in many ways, more connected to his actor than the average character. After all, so much of what makes the show special is based around how much that character changes when he changes actors.
I totally agree with several other people in this thread that I've liked several Doctors way more after reading/watching some interviews with their actors. DW fandom is pretty lucky with how many of its actors and actresses appear to be honestly lovely and intelligent people in real life, and at how engaged with the show many of them seem to still be, even the ones for whom its decades after the fact.
Plus, it was Tennant's enthusiasm that got me from 'I like this show' to 'FANDOM!', and from 'I like the new series' to 'Well, if he's so excited about the Classic series, it's certainly worth a go'.
(Which then turned into me liking certain portions of Classic Who quite a lot better)
